About this course

The International Postgraduate Certificate of Education (iPGCE) programme is designed to support educators who are currently in practice outside the UK. This level 7 (Masters Level) course develops practical teaching skills, while deepening your critical awareness of education in rapidly changing global contexts. You will gain valuable knowledge relevant to all subjects and curricula, encouraging you to consider new ways of understanding teaching, learning and education in an international context.

The iPGCE gives a grounding in contemporary pedagogy, while providing challenge and deeper critical perspectives for established professionals. It is designed to be completed alongside full-time employment as a teacher. It allows you to engage flexibly at times to suit you, so you can work round your ongoing professional commitments. Unlike many other qualifications, the iPGCE does not rely upon active support or involvement from other staff or management in your setting and can be completed successfully whatever educational system or curricular framework you teach within.
